A mail-in rebate is a type of promotion offered by Canon (or any other company) where you can receive a rebate or discount on a product by sending in a proof of purchase and other required documentation.
Here's a general outline of how a Canon mail-in rebate typically works:
- Purchase a qualifying product: Look for Canon products that are eligible for a mail-in rebate. These products are usually marked with a "Mail-in Rebate" or "Rebate" sticker.
- Register your product: Go to Canon's website and register your product to receive a rebate form.
- Fill out the rebate form: Complete the rebate form with your name, address, and other required information.
- Attach proof of purchase: Include a copy of your receipt or invoice as proof of purchase.
- Mail the rebate form and proof of purchase: Send the completed rebate form and proof of purchase to the address specified on the rebate form.
- Wait for your rebate: Canon will process your rebate and send you a check or credit your account with the rebate amount.
Some things to keep in mind when submitting a Canon mail-in rebate:
- Make sure you meet the eligibility criteria: Check the rebate form for any specific requirements, such as purchase dates, product models, or minimum purchase amounts.
- Fill out the form accurately: Double-check your information to ensure it's correct and complete.
- Keep a copy of your rebate form and proof of purchase: In case there's an issue with your rebate, you'll want to have a copy of the documents you submitted.
- Allow time for processing: Rebates can take several weeks to process, so plan accordingly.
